Output fc69bb99bd24b4265f8f63b7f6a009b7a088319bf4b2c451f50b439509e9af5e:25

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64a640112b825b9d3ece59c699ce677552e6aeaf OP_EQUAL
address
3AsCezos8P6Qastn5SjS88F8WUtN7jGm2F
transaction
fc69bb99bd24b4265f8f63b7f6a009b7a088319bf4b2c451f50b439509e9af5e
confirmations
374810
spent
true